Roberto Martinez has today confirmed Bosnia and Herzegovina international Muhamed Besic will be presented as an Everton player when the team return from Thailand next week.
Everton travelled to Thailand on Thursday afternoon and the 21-year-old has travelled with the squad to build his fitness.
Martinez said: “The next few days will allow Mo to meet the players, but more importantly it is an opportunity for him to get into optimum condition ahead of the new season.
“I am looking forward to introducing him to the Everton fans when we come back but first I would like to thank Ferencváros for the way in which they have approached the negotiations. They have been very understanding at this point and we have enjoyed a good working relationship.”
Martinez, meanwhile, takes a squad of 22 players to the Thai capital as he continues with his pre-season preparations.
